Watch: ‘Love yourself’? College appears to cancel self-pleasure workshop event after backlash
February 07, 2018
College kids apparently have a lot to learn.
The Undergraduate Student Government of Arizona State University, Tempe was planning to host a workshop on masturbation titled “Go Love Yourself.”
While the event seems to have been pulled from Facebook, Campus Reform grabbed screenshots of the event description, which advertised a “shame-free, pleasure-focused discussion about masturbation and self-exploration to get the pleasure you want and deserve.”
Campus Reform writer Nikita Vladimirov joined today’s show to talk about this odd story. Schools try to justify hosting and funding events like this one by saying it’s about health.
“Every time these programs get criticized in the media or in the press, they say, ‘Oh, but it’s for health-related reasons. But all that is, is a talking point,” Vladimirov explained.
